Classical electromagnetism vs. Wavelength

Classical electromagnetism or classical electrodynamics is a branch of theoretical physics that studies the interactions between electric charges and currents using an extension of the classical Newtonian model. In physics, the wavelength is the spatial period of a periodic wave—the distance over which the wave's shape repeats.
